Understanding Digital Art Platforms Funding in Rural Communities

Digital art platforms funding is a specialized grant initiative designed to support the creation and enhancement of digital platforms for rural artists. This form of funding covers the development of websites, online marketplaces, and digital communities that facilitate artists' visibility and access to broader markets. Excluded from this funding are physical infrastructure improvements and direct financial support for art creation. The primary focus remains on integrating digital technology into the artistic processes of rural communities.

Several use cases illustrate the impactful role of digital art platforms in rural settings. For instance, a rural artist may use grant funding to establish an online gallery showcasing their artwork, effectively reaching national or even international buyers. Another example can be seen in a collective of artisans who establish a digital marketplace to sell handmade crafts, thus eliminating the geographical constraints that previously limited their customer base and revenue potential. Furthermore, workshops funded by this initiative could provide necessary training for artists to build personal websites or utilize social media effectively, enhancing their marketing skills and improving sales.

The funding appeals to a diverse array of applicants, primarily aiming at individual artists, small art collectives, and community organizations focusing on digital arts. However, it is crucial that applicants have a demonstrated commitment to improving their digital engagement and can showcase how the funding will directly benefit their visibility and commercial prospects. Conversely, large-scale projects lacking a clear focus on rural outreach or community integration would not find eligibility within this funding initiative. Additionally, applicants who do not have a defined project plan or measurable outcomes may struggle to qualify.
